Understanding the Mechanics of Crypto Scams

Crypto scams are notorious for their complexity and deceitful nature, often evolving new tactics to stay ahead of potential detection.One such scam type is known as “pig butchering,” where scammers meticulously build a relationship with their victims. Initially, they engage the target through social interactions, gradually establishing trust. Once trust is established, they introduce the idea of investing in what appears to be highly lucrative cryptocurrency portfolios. The victims, lured by the prospect of high returns, start investing small amounts. As the scammers falsify profits and gains, victims are convinced to invest larger sums, eventually losing significant amounts of money.

The deception is not limited to mere investment pitches. Scammers often coach their victims to respond in specific ways if questioned by authorities, further embedding their trust and dependency on them. During the FBI’s Operation Level Up, it was found that victims often used terminology and explanations crafted by the scammers themselves. This manipulation adds layers of complexity, making it extremely difficult for victims to recognize and acknowledge they are being scammed.Enhancing awareness and understanding the intricacies of these schemes are crucial in mitigating the risk of falling prey to such fraud.

The Increasing Prevalence of Crypto Scams

The rise in popularity of cryptocurrencies has inevitably brought about a surge in related scams, with sheer financial losses increasingly alarming.The case of the Maryland woman is a microcosm of a much larger issue that transcends borders. Crypto scams have particularly targeted novice investors, many of whom utilize platforms like Coinbase. These scams generally propose investments into fake portfolios that seem too good to pass up. As victims commit more funds, the realization of the scam often comes too late, with personal losses sometimes running into millions of dollars.A significant aspect of these scams is their evolving nature and ability to morph into new forms. After an initial scam is discovered, scammers may re-target their victims by posing as recovery firms, promising to help retrieve lost funds for an upfront fee. This vicious cycle can devastate the victims not just financially but also psychologically. It highlights the importance of constant vigilance and skepticism toward unsolicited investment opportunities.Keeping abreast of common scam tactics and their warning signs can serve as a first line of defense against these fraudulent activities.

Steps to Protect Yourself from Crypto Scams

Avoiding sophisticated crypto scams requires a multi-faceted approach, combining education, skepticism, and proactive security measures.First and foremost, it is vital to understand some basic principles of cryptocurrency investments. Genuine investments in the crypto space should never promise guaranteed high returns, similar to any legitimate financial market.If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is. Always verify the credibility of the investment opportunity and the platform offering it through independent research and reviews.

Another crucial step is protection against phishing attacks. Scammers frequently use fake emails, social media messages, and websites to lure victims into revealing critical personal and financial information. Ensure that communication channels and websites are secure, and do not click on suspicious links or download unverified attachments.Utilize multi-factor authentication (MFA) and change passwords regularly to enhance account security. Installing reliable antivirus software and staying updated with the latest security patches can also minimize the risk of falling victim to cyber-attacks.

Additionally, increased vigilance towards information sources is imperative. Scammers often exploit trending topics and garner information through social engineering techniques. Conducting thorough background checks before engaging in any financial transactions is essential. Consult with a financial advisor or professional who specializes in cryptocurrencies if uncertain about an investment decision.Learning from verified educational platforms and staying updated with the latest trends and news in cryptocurrency can considerably reduce vulnerability to scams.
